The sliding bevel is primarily designed for marking or measuring angles. It consists of a ruler and a pivoting arm that allows the user to set the angle to be marked. By adjusting the arm to the desired angle against the edge of a workpiece, the sliding bevel can then easily transfer that angle onto the material, making it invaluable for carpentry, metalworking, and other applications requiring precise angular measurements.

This tool is particularly useful in situations where accurate sharp angles are needed, such as when framing structures or laying out joints. The ability to quickly adjust and lock the angle allows for repeatable and consistent markings, which is fundamental in ensuring that pieces fit together properly. Other tools, such as levels or tape measures, serve different purposes and are not primarily oriented toward angle marking.
